Arrowslit window
Arrowslit window
There are several narrow windows in the Shippon, which are done with plain stone blocks. These are said to be arrowslits from the castle, but the use of very narrow slits as ventilation, which will keep out the rain but allow in fresh air, are common practice in Shippons. Not that the stone might not have come from the castle - it is good quality stuff for a shippon. But this one slit has carved stones and is probably the best candidate for being very old as well as re-used. It is on the southern gable end.

The Shippon Barn

Shippon Barn is a grade II listed building, used in part by the trustees of the BUC who maintain the wellhead park, and in part by the Boy Scouts and Girl Guides of Bourne. This is a grade II listed building, and the listing suggests that the narrow stone window-slits may have been reused from Bourne Castle.

Shippon or shippen is a dialect word for a cow-house, coming from old English "Scipene", meaning "cattle-shed". The word would normally be used alone, so 'Shippon Barn' is nearly tautological.
